Vispop is a nationwide songwriting campaign that encourages Visayan-speaking composers and music enthusiasts to write quality Visayan songs that speak of today’s generation. It is set to put the Bisaya language and music in the mainstream consciousness of listeners.

The first batches of Vispop finalists and winners captured the hearts of not just Cebuano listeners but non-Cebuano speaking music fans all over the country as well. It produced well-crafted songs such as Duyog, Laylay, and Papictura ko Nimo, Guapo, Bok Love, Dili Pa Panahon, Labyu Langga, Buwag Balik, among others. The songs have been topping charts nationwide.

Now on its 4th year, Vispop is once again set to make waves with its new set of six (6) finalists meticulously chosen from among 360 entries from all over the country’s Visayan-speaking regions.

TRIVIA: Vispop is a brainchild of Artist and Musicians Marketing Cooperative, commonly known as ArtistKo, a non-profit, non-stock organization that supports individual creativity, skill and talent. Having artists, musicians and entrepreneurs as members, the cooperative aims to mount self-help mechanisms to provide benefits to all its members and continuously develop the local music and arts. ArtistKo’s biggest project, Vispop, was conceptualized in 2009 and had its first staging in 2013.

Vispop is supported by Filipino Society of Composers, Authors and Publishers, Inc. (FILSCAP) and Cebu Chamber of Commerce and Industry, Inc.

Everland (Gyeonggi-do)

Everland Korea

Everland is basically Korea’s Disneyland. The amusement park is divided into five sections: Global Fair, Zoo-Topia, European Adventure, Magic Land and American Adventure. And much like it’s Disneyland counterpart, there’s a slew of roller coasters, drops, and rides to go on. In the summer season, live DJs and singers often come out for an Everland concert.

N Seoul Tower

N_Seoul_Tower

Built on a 262 meter peak in Namsan Park, the tower reaches to 480 meters above sea level. When the weather and pollution levels cooperate, visiting the observation tower (370 meters above sea level) allows you to view the entire city and surrounding areas. N Seoul tower offers some of the most breathtaking views of Seoul. It’s breathtaking to watch the city light up at night as the sun sets. It’s highly recommended visiting later in the day so you can witness the sunset. There is a restaurant in the tower that offers dinner as well as snack and coffee counters.

Gwang-An Bridge (Busan)

Gwang-An Bridge

Also known as the Diamond Bridge, this two-story bridge connects Suyeong-gu and Haeundae-gu and offers an astonishing view of mountains, sandy beaches, hills and city lights. Kwang-An Bridge is not for pedestrians, but anyone can enjoy the spectacular night view of the bridge from afar; its state-of-the-art lighting system allows an exterior lighting of over 100,000 colors.

Boryeong Mud Festival (Boryeong)

Boryeong Mud Festival (Boryeong)

It’s not exactly a place, but a very interesting event that every tourist should witness. The event that brings out probably the most international attendees, the Boryeong Mud Festival is all about playing with mud. Mud wrestling, mud sliding, and mud swimming are all fair game at the event. You can even get a mud message, if wrestling with your fellow attendee isn’t your cup of tea. During all these mud festivities, music can be heard in the background, while fireworks are shot later at night. It usually happens mid-July for 10 days.

360 Cassette

360 Cassette

Unlike previous traditional air conditioning units, the cutting-edge design of the bladeless 360 Cassette delivers a zero angle airflow, producing a layer of cold air and minimizing flow reduction by 25 percent. With a temperature deviation of less than 0.6°C across an area spanning a diameter of 9.3m, the new 360 Cassette from Samsung provides increased power efficiency without producing a cold draft, delivering an optimal cooling performance.

Samsung DVM Chiller

Samsung DVM Chiller

In the revolutionary DVM Chiller, Samsung has embedded the world-class BLDC Inverter Scroll Compressor with Flash Injection technology, ensuring heating capacity at -20°C ambient temperature with greater energy efficiency. The Chiller enables users to reduce annual utility costs by 36 percent to 50 percent compared to conventional chillers.

Samsung DVM S 30HP

The new Samsung DVM S 30HP features a number of revolutionary features to boost performance, including a new Super Inverter Scroll Compressor with flash injection technology and an optimized bypass valve location to increase heating capacity by 29 percent.

Samsung DVM S 30HP

The further addition of a hybrid heat exchanger increases the heat exchange area while an optimized refrigerant control delivers greater efficiency (10 percent) and a new oval-shaped diffuser application improves the airflow path and increases the airflow rate by 17 percent.
